AWAKERI SCOUTS
BREAKING UP EVENING
DEMONSTRATIONS AND DLS PLAYS One of those bright evenings Tor which scouting in this, district, is now becoming well known took place last Saturday night when Scouts of the Awakeri troop staged their breaking up gathering lor 1944. There was. a good attendance of parents and friends and an interesting programme of sketches and scout demonstrations was warmly appreciated. Scoutmaster T. who was in charge of the proceedings briefly addressed the gathering and ex plained from time to time the objectives of the training and the meaning of the various displays.. The Chairman of Mr N. Carter ? also took a prominent part in. the evening assisted by the Secretary and Mr W. H. Rushbrooke. One of the most humourous items was a realistic skit*on the trials of motoring which was handled by the Scouts in a manner which fairly doubled up the spectators-. Following a dainty supper provided by the the Commissioner for the district took the. opportunity of ad-, dressing the assemblage congratulating the troop on the standard it had attained and expressing the hope that, he. would see all boys attending the annual camp in the New Year. He also presented two of the boys with their Second Class badges. The gathering broke up with an informal dance in which all participated.
